How to add shelving in a rental?

Adding shelving to a rental property can be a great way to increase storage space and reduce clutter. However, many renters are hesitant to make permanent changes to their space. The good news is that there are several creative and non-invasive ways to add shelving in a rental without causing damage or violating your lease agreement.

One of the simplest and most versatile solutions is to use freestanding or modular shelving units. These types of shelves do not require any drilling or hardware installation, making them perfect for rental properties. They are also easy to move around and can be customized to fit your specific storage needs.

Another option is to use adhesive hooks and hanging shelves. Adhesive hooks can be attached to walls without causing damage, and hanging shelves can be easily mounted on them. This can be a great way to add some extra storage space without making any permanent changes to the property.

If you do need to drill holes for shelving, try to use existing holes or studs if possible. This will minimize damage to the walls and make it easier to repair when you move out. Be sure to check with your landlord or property manager before making any holes, as some leases may prohibit drilling.

4. Are there any temporary shelving solutions for renters?

Yes, there are many temporary shelving solutions available, such as tension rod shelves, over-the-door organizers, and removable adhesive shelves.

10. How can I maximize storage space with shelving in a rental?

You can maximize storage space by utilizing vertical wall space, adding shelves above doorways or windows, and using under-shelf baskets or hooks for extra storage.

11. Can I install shelves in the bathroom of a rental property?

Yes, you can install shelves in the bathroom of a rental property. Consider using moisture-resistant materials such as glass or plastic for added durability.

12. What should I do with shelving when I move out of a rental property?

Before moving out, be sure to carefully remove any shelving or hardware that you have installed. Patch any holes or damage to the walls to ensure a smooth transition for the next tenant.
